Application

EC Number Application Comment Organism
3.2.1.14 agriculture due to the potential of broad-spectrum antifungal activity barley chitinase gene can be used to enhance fungal-resistance in crop plants such as rice, tobacco, tea and clover Hordeum vulgare

Cloned(Commentary)

EC Number Cloned (Comment) Organism
3.2.1.14 overexpression in Escherichia coli. Since the protein is produced as insoluble inclusion bodies, the protein is solubilized and refolded Hordeum vulgare

Substrates and Products (Substrate)

EC Number Substrates Comment Substrates Organism Products Comment (Products) Rev. Reac.
3.2.1.14 additional information purified chitinase exerts broad-spectrum antifungal activity against Botrytis cinerea (blight of tobacco), Pestalotia theae (leaf spot of tea), Bipolaris oryzae (brown spot of rice), Alternaria sp. (grain discoloration of rice), Curvularia lunata (leaf spot of clover) and Rhizoctonia solani (sheath blight of rice) Hordeum vulgare ?
